coverage: Exclude test suites and /usr from coverage report

This commit is contained in:
Tobias Brunner 2017-03-15 15:54:38 +01:00
parent 42f7c98980
commit 3bc8a4a581
1 changed files with 1 additions and 1 deletions

View File

@ -54,7 +54,7 @@ cov-report:
@mkdir $(top_builddir)/coverage
lcov -c -o $(top_builddir)/coverage/coverage.info -d $(top_builddir) \
--rc lcov_branch_coverage=1
lcov -r $(top_builddir)/coverage/coverage.info '*/tests/*' \
lcov -r $(top_builddir)/coverage/coverage.info '*/tests/*' '*/suites/*' '/usr*' \
-o $(top_builddir)/coverage/coverage.cleaned.info \
--rc lcov_branch_coverage=1
genhtml --num-spaces 4 --legend --branch-coverage --ignore-errors source \